Learning and Instruction | 2002

The semantic effects of consulting a textual database on rewriting.

Jacques Crinon; Denis Legros

Abstract Children 8-10-years old were asked to write a story and then to improve it using resource texts. A first group accessed the resource texts through a computer database, a second group read the texts on paper and no texts were given to a third group. Regardless of their reading abilities, the children using computers produced more propositions during rewriting and, in particular, more macrostructural propositions. Inventions inspired by the resource texts outnumbered borrowings, particularly in the computer-assisted group. Our interpretation stresses the effect of the database learning environment on the reprocessing of mental models involved in generating first drafts.


Computer Standards & Interfaces | 2009

Random indexing and the episodic memory metaphor. Application to text categorization

Yann Vigile Hoareau; Adil El Ghali; Denis Legros; Kaoutar El Ghali

A model of episodic memory is derived to propose algorithms of text categorization with semantic space models. Performances of two algorithms are contrasted using textual material of the text-mining context ‘DEFT09’. Results confirm that the episodic memory metaphor provides a convenient framework to propose efficient algorithm for text categorization. One algorithm has already been tested with LSA. The present paper extends these algorithms to another model of Word Vector named Random Indexing.


Contexts | 1999

How Context Contributes to Metaphor Understanding

Béatrice Pudelko; Elizabeth Hamilton; Denis Legros; Charles Tijus

The objective of this study is to show how the contextual knowledge about the topic allows choosing one out of the many interpretations possible for attributive metaphors of the form [A (the topic) is B (the vehicle)]. We propose an experiment that shows (i) that the properties of the vehicle that are actually attributed to the topic are the ones that are specified by the context in which the topic appears; and (ii) that conventional interpretations of a metaphor do not predominate unless this context is neutral, i.e. when the attributes of the topic furnished by the context do not belong to the vehicles category. We interpret these results on the importance of the context in understanding metaphor both in terms of property matching [1, 4, 7] and in terms of categorization [2, 8]. In our approach, understanding a metaphor consists of including the topic in a category specified by the vehicle such that the topic inherits certain of the traits of this category, within a situational object category network.
